Control interface agent system and method
First Claim
1. A computer that is interconnected with a native control system and a non-native control system that are connected to control a process, wherein said native control system comprises a control processor interconnected with at least one native device via a native bus and wherein said non-native control system comprises first and second non-native devices connected to a non-native bus, said computer comprising:
- a configuration program that provides configuration data to said control processor to configure said control processor with a control program that when run controls and monitors said process using said at least one native device and said first and second non-native devices and responds to a signal from said first non-native device to cause said second non-native device to perform an action for control of said process and that configures a control interface agent with control data flow connections of said control processor and said first and second non-native devices for control of said process, wherein said configuration program transfers said control interface agent to a gateway interface device that is connected to said non-native bus of said non-native control system and to said control processor of said native control system via a network, wherein said control processor when running said control program controls the operation of said first and second non-native devices in the control of said process via the control data flow connections of said control interface agent, wherein said control interface agent is further configured to translate a status expressed in a native language to a non-native language and vice versa, and wherein said status is provided by one of said first and second non-native devices.
1 Assignment
0 Petitions
Accused Products
Abstract
A control system that integrates an native control system and a non-native control system is disclosed. Data is exchanged between the two systems via a gateway interface device. Control interface objects are run on the gateway interface device to provide the exchange of data. The control interface agent configuration is based on the control connections of a native device and a non-native device.
-
Citations
10 Claims
-
1. A computer that is interconnected with a native control system and a non-native control system that are connected to control a process, wherein said native control system comprises a control processor interconnected with at least one native device via a native bus and wherein said non-native control system comprises first and second non-native devices connected to a non-native bus, said computer comprising:
a configuration program that provides configuration data to said control processor to configure said control processor with a control program that when run controls and monitors said process using said at least one native device and said first and second non-native devices and responds to a signal from said first non-native device to cause said second non-native device to perform an action for control of said process and that configures a control interface agent with control data flow connections of said control processor and said first and second non-native devices for control of said process, wherein said configuration program transfers said control interface agent to a gateway interface device that is connected to said non-native bus of said non-native control system and to said control processor of said native control system via a network, wherein said control processor when running said control program controls the operation of said first and second non-native devices in the control of said process via the control data flow connections of said control interface agent, wherein said control interface agent is further configured to translate a status expressed in a native language to a non-native language and vice versa, and wherein said status is provided by one of said first and second non-native devices. - View Dependent Claims (2, 3, 4)
-
5. A method for controlling a process with a control system that comprises a computer that is interconnected with a native control system and a non-native control system that are connected to control a process, wherein said native control system comprises a control processor interconnected with a least one native device via a native bus and wherein said non-native control system comprises first and second non-native devices connected to a non-native bus, comprising:
-
providing said computer with a configuration program that configures said control processor with a control program that when run controls and monitors said process using said at least one native device and said first and second non-native devices and responds to a signal from said first non-native device to cause said second non-native device to perform an action for control of said process; providing a control interface agent with control data flow connections between said control processor via a network and said first and second non-native devices via said non-native bus for control of said process; and controlling said process with said control processor running said control program to control the operation of said first and second non-native devices via the control data low connections of said control interface agent, wherein said control interface agent is provided in a gateway interface device that interconnected with said control processor of said native control system and said non-native bus of said non-native control system, wherein said control interface agent is further configured to translate a status expressed in a native language to a non-native language and vice versa, and wherein said status is provided by one of said first non-native device, second non-native device and said process controller. - View Dependent Claims (6, 7, 8, 9, 10)
-
Specification